Course number and title : LIN204H5S English Grammar I Course description : Students will learn about fundamental grammatical concepts, focusing on the major grammatical categories in English and how they interact at the phrase level. They will be introduced to the main constituents of English sentences and learn about the basic relationship between tense, aspect, and modality. Students will learn to apply this knowledge as a tool to think analytically about English, evaluating various registers and styles, and gaining an awareness of their own style of speaking and writing. Minimum qualifications : Ph.D. in Linguistics or a related field is required. Mastery of subject material (English syntax from a theoretical linguistic perspective), with a background in theoretical linguistics is required. Demonstrated excellence and experience teaching university-level Linguistics courses is required. Preferred qualifications : Preference will be given to applicants with ongoing linguistic research related to the subject area and with experience teaching the same, or a similar, course in Linguistics. Experience in course management through Quercus/Canvas is also preferred. Preference in hiring is given to qualified individuals advanced to the rank of Sessional Lecturer II and Sessional Lecturer III in accordance with Article 14:12. Description of duties : All normal duties related to the design and teaching of a University credit course, including preparation and delivery of course content; out-of-class interactions with students via e-mail and office hours; development, administration, and marking of assignments, tests and exams; calculation and submission of grades; ordering all necessary readings; supervising TAs (if any) assigned to the course.
